What is a 4G 5G Packet Core engineer?

A 4G/5G Packet Core engineer is a telecommunications professional responsible for designing, implementing, maintaining, and troubleshooting the core network systems that manage data traffic in 4G and 5G mobile networks. The Packet Core is a crucial part of the mobile network, handling user data, internet connectivity, and session management. Engineers in this role work with technologies such as EPC (Evolved Packet Core) for 4G and 5GC (5G Core) for 5G, ensuring seamless data communication and high network performance for users.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a 4G 5G Packet Core engineer?

To thrive as a 4G/5G Packet Core Engineer, you need a deep understanding of mobile core network architecture, protocols (such as GTP, Diameter, and SCTP), and a degree in telecommunications or a related field. Familiarity with network management systems, virtualization technologies (like VMware or OpenStack), and certifications such as CCNA/CCNP or vendor-specific credentials (e.g., Nokia, Ericsson) are typically required.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and strong teamwork and communication skills help engineers navigate complex network issues and collaborate effectively. Mastery of these skills ensures robust, reliable network performance and supports the rapid evolution of mobile communications.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in 4G 5G Packet Core roles and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in 4G/5G Packet Core roles often encounter challenges such as integrating new network technologies with legacy systems, ensuring network scalability, and maintaining high availability and security. Addressing these challenges requires staying current with evolving standards, collaborating closely with cross-functional teams (like radio access and operations), and leveraging automation tools to streamline configuration and monitoring. Continuous learning and proactive communication within the team are key to successfully managing complex packet core networks.
